Abstract

Provided herein are a household appliance and a method for using a heat pump in a household appliance, which may include a household appliance for washing and drying goods. The household appliance may include a processing chamber for receiving goods to be washed and dried, and a heat pump having a warm side provided with a condenser and a cold side provided with an evaporator, wherein the condenser may be adapted to heat water to be used in the processing chamber and the evaporator may be adapted to cool a liquid in a heat reservoir for storing heat generated on the cold side of the heat pump during heating of the condenser. The condenser may be arranged in a water tank adapted to provide water to the processing chamber.
